HSTCP拥塞控制算法及其改进策略的研究

来源 :大连理工大学 | 被引量 : 0次 | 上传用户:mai120117
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着计算机网络的普及和网络用户急剧增加,网络拥塞控制机制的研究变得越来越重要。TCP是一项从实践中诞生的,并在实践中不断得到发展和完善的网络技术,也是目前在Internet中使用最广泛,占主导地位的端到端传输协议,当今Internet的稳定性与TCP成功的拥塞控制算法密不可分。TCP Reno是目前应用最广泛的较为成熟的TCP拥塞控制算法,然而随着高带宽大时延网络在实际中的的应用,TCP Reno性能表现出很大的弊端。目前,国内外对高速网络方向的研究逐步发展,因此出现了一些代表性的高速源算法,其中HSTCP以其算法实现简单,具有良好的可扩展性而获得了更多的关注,它是建立在TCP Reno的AIMD思想的基础上的改进方案,同时根据当前窗口的大小相应调整其拥塞窗口。然而它存在着性能上的一些问题制约着其广泛的应用。本文在分析TCP Reno应用于高速网络中的局限性的基础上,系统了研究HSTCP的拥塞控制算法,分析了HSTCP算法性能上的不足,并掘此提出了改进的proHSTCP算法。该算法针对HSTCP慢启动后期窗口增加过快,和Reno共存时的友好性以及RTT公平性等问题进行了改进。改进的proHSTCP拥塞控制算法对慢启动后续的窗口增长方式进行了改进,在拥塞避免阶段增加了公平性因子,并根据在拥塞避免阶段总的瓶颈通道是否被完全利用来决定采用什么样的拥塞避免算法。如果瓶颈通道没有被完全利用,那么就采用HSTCP拥塞避免算法,快速的递增拥塞窗口去利用未被利用的带宽;如果瓶颈通道被完全利用了,那么就采用较小的递增参数算法与普通TCP数据流进行竞争。理论上来说,采用proHSTCP算法的数据流在与普通TCP数据流共存时要比采用HSTCP算法的数据流更友好,同时,这种算法也明显改善了RTT公平性的问题。通过一系列的仿真实验研究,结果表明改进的proHSTCP算法具有良好的性能。
其他文献
计算智能是一种从生物底层对智能行为进行模拟和研究的仿生计算方法,它拓展了传统的计算模式,具有自学习、自组织、自适应的特点和简单、通用、鲁棒性强、适于并行处理等优点
电子分析天平是一种集传感器技术、电磁学、模拟与数字电子技术、智能信息处理、材料、结构力学、精密机械与制造等多学科技术的高尖端精密计量仪器,是广泛应用于国防、医药、质量控制、实验室等领域的质量计量标准器具。活体动物称量是科学研究的重要手段,是现代科学技术的重要组成部分,因此直接影响着研究课题的成败和水平的高低,它的提高和发展,又会把许多领域课题的研究引入新的境界。因此,在实验室研制的220g/0.1
随着社会经济的发展,驾驶疲劳己成为引发交通事故的主要因素之一。因此,如何有效的检测和防止驾驶疲劳,对于降低交通事故发生率及人员死亡率有着十分重要的意义。 本文在大量
现代运载体对导航系统的精度和可靠性提出了越来越高的要求,各种导航系统单独使用时难以满足导航性能需要,因此组合导航成为导航系统发展的趋势,捷联惯性导航系统(SINS)/GPS
无线传感器网络(Wireless Sensor Network)融合了传感器技术、信息处理技术和网络通信技术。无线传感器网络是一种由侦察与监测功能发展出来的网络架构模式,通过无线网络实现
预测控制是从上世纪70年代发展起来的新型控制算法,具有对模型要求低、滚动优化、能有效处理约束问题等诸多优点,在工业过程控制中应用广泛,是最具应用推广价值的先进控制策略之
在实际监控视频场景中,由于外部光照的变化、前景运动目标扰动以及场景中某些背景本身的变化,很难保证背景模型的准确性。因此,建立实时适应场景变化的背景模型具有重要意义
随着现代交通网络的飞速发展、城市机动车数量的不断增加,交通违章事件的智能管理己经成为现代交通管理的需要。目前,在世界上很多国家已经开始采用智能化的电子警察系统来进
电力需求侧技术的研究,是智能电网建设中的重点内容。当前,我国用电高峰期电力短缺与电能管理的问题日益严重,对企业的生产效率和居民的生活水平造成了一定程度的影响。因此,提高
滑模变结构控制算法以其强鲁棒性、对系统内部参数以及外部干扰不敏感而著称。而作为传统一阶滑模的理论推广,高阶滑模控制因其抑制抖振、且控制精度更高、适用范围更广的优点